Finished the stairs today despite rain all weekend. 39 led lights in the risers. little tiny things that mount in a 7/8" hole and do an amazing job at lighting the stairs.

The pool deck drains towards the wood deck. If you can see the white spacers under the stairs, they are to prevent rotting and allow rain runoff to drain freely into weeping tile (weeping tile is under stairs)

I'm back..........you know what comes now............questions LOL

Where does the water from the weeping tile work go?

How did you put those tiny lights in? Before you put the board they are in on? How are they wired? Are they all in a string line?

Can't wait for my night pic!

Kim:kim:
 
Water collected in weeping system dumps out behind my retaining wall and down a hill.

Lights are wired in series but not like your old Christmas lights when one goes out they all do. lol. They come 10 in a pack with a transformer. you install in facia or risers then connect wires and put deck board back on. I have 4 sets with 4 transformers. You could put more than 10 on one transformer but I read that you get a diminishing life span.
